Should you invest in cryptocurrency (crypto)?
In today's rapidly evolving financial landscape, the question of whether to invest in cryptocurrency has become increasingly pertinent. Cryptocurrency, or crypto, offers the promise of decentralized, secure, and potentially lucrative investment opportunities. However, with its inherent volatility and complex nature, the decision to invest in crypto is not without its risks. So, should you dive into the crypto world? Let's delve deeper into the key considerations to help you make an informed decision. First and foremost, you need to understand the fundamentals of cryptocurrency. Cryptocurrencies are digital assets that utilize encryption techniques to secure and verify transactions. They operate on a decentralized ledger known as a blockchain, eliminating the need for traditional intermediaries like banks. This unique structure offers several potential advantages, including transparency, security, and efficiency. However, the crypto market is highly volatile, and prices can fluctuate significantly. This means that investing in crypto requires a significant amount of risk tolerance. You must be prepared for the possibility of significant losses, especially in the short term. Additionally, the crypto market is still relatively new and unregulated, making it prone to scams and manipulation. It's crucial to do your research and invest in well-known, trusted projects. Another important consideration is the potential long-term value of cryptocurrency. While the market may be volatile in the short term, crypto has the potential to revolutionize the financial system in the long run. Cryptocurrencies could potentially disrupt traditional banking, payment systems, and even government-issued currencies. As more people and institutions adopt crypto, its value and usage could continue to grow. In conclusion, investing in cryptocurrency is a complex decision that requires careful consideration. You need to understand the fundamentals of crypto, be prepared for volatility and risk, and consider the potential long-term value. If you're comfortable with the risks and believe in the future of crypto, then investing in it could be a rewarding decision. However, it's essential to proceed with caution and only invest what you can afford to lose.
